Nociception—the ability to feel pain—is essential for an organism’s survival and overall well-being. Noxious stimuli such as piercing pain from a sharp object, heat from an open flame, or contact with corrosive chemicals are first detected by sensory receptors, called nociceptors, located on nerve endings. Nociceptors express ion channels that convert noxious stimuli into electrical signals. When these signals reach the brain via sensory neurons, they are perceived as pain.

Technology for chronic pain.

Suyi Zhang1, Ben Seymour2

  • 1Center for Information and Neural Networks, NICT, Japan.

Current Biology : CB
|September 24, 2014
PubMed
Summary
This summary is machine-generated.

New technologies are advancing chronic pain management beyond medication. Innovations aim to objectively measure pain and offer novel technology-based treatments, addressing key challenges in pain care.

Area of Science:

  • Biomedical Engineering
  • Neuroscience
  • Digital Health

Background:

  • Chronic pain management traditionally relies on pharmacology, facing limitations.
  • Evolving technology offers new avenues for pain diagnosis and treatment.
  • Addressing the subjective nature of pain and developing objective measures are key challenges.

Purpose of the Study:

  • To review recent technological advancements in chronic pain management.
  • To highlight innovations addressing objective pain measurement.
  • To showcase technology-based interventions for pain management.

Main Methods:

  • Review of recent scientific literature and technological developments.
  • Analysis of emerging objective pain assessment tools.
  • Exploration of novel technology-driven pain intervention strategies.

Main Results:

  • Significant progress in developing objective pain assessment technologies.
  • Emergence of diverse technology-based interventions for pain management.
  • Promising solutions for both diagnosis and treatment of chronic pain.

Conclusions:

  • Technological innovation is rapidly transforming chronic pain management.
  • Objective measures and technology-based interventions are crucial for future pain care.
  • Recent developments offer new hope for individuals with chronic pain.
